1. Raw Material Selection
The process of creating Medicinal Marshmallow Extract powder begins with the careful selection of raw materials. Medicinal marshmallow (Althaea officinalis) is the primary source. When choosing the plants for extraction, several factors come into play.
1.1. Plant Source
The plants should preferably be sourced from regions with a clean environment, free from pollutants such as heavy metals and pesticides. Ideally, they are grown organically to ensure the highest quality. Marshmallow plants are typically harvested during a specific time of the year when the active compounds are at their peak concentration. For example, the roots are often harvested in the fall when they have had time to accumulate the maximum amount of beneficial substances.
1.2. Quality Inspection
Before the extraction process begins, a thorough quality inspection of the raw materials is essential. This includes visual inspection for any signs of disease, damage, or foreign matter. Additionally, laboratory tests may be conducted to determine the presence of contaminants and the concentration of key active ingredients. Only plants that meet strict quality standards are selected for further processing.
2. Extraction Methods
There are several extraction methods used to obtain the Medicinal Marshmallow Extract powder, each with its own advantages and disadvantages.
2.1. Solvent Extraction
One of the most common methods is solvent extraction. Ethanol or water can be used as solvents. In this process, the dried and crushed marshmallow roots or other parts of the plant are soaked in the solvent. The solvent helps to dissolve the active compounds present in the plant material. After a certain period of soaking, the mixture is filtered to separate the liquid extract from the solid plant residue. The solvent is then evaporated, leaving behind the concentrated extract, which can be further processed into a powder form.
2.2. Supercritical Fluid Extraction
Supercritical fluid extraction is a more advanced and precise method. Carbon dioxide is often used as the supercritical fluid. Under specific temperature and pressure conditions, carbon dioxide reaches a supercritical state where it has the properties of both a liquid and a gas. This supercritical carbon dioxide can effectively extract the active compounds from the marshmallow plant. The advantage of this method is that it can be more selective in extracting the desired compounds, and it leaves no solvent residues, resulting in a purer extract.
3. Quality Control
Quality control is a crucial aspect of Medicinal Marshmallow Extract powder processing to ensure its safety and effectiveness.
3.1. Ingredient Analysis
During the production process, regular analysis of the ingredients in the extract is carried out. This involves determining the concentration of key active components such as mucilage, flavonoids, and polysaccharides. High - performance liquid chromatography (HPLC) and gas chromatography - mass spectrometry (GC - MS) are some of the techniques used for this purpose. By closely monitoring the ingredient levels, manufacturers can ensure that the product meets the expected quality standards.
3.2. Microbiological Testing
Microbiological testing is also an important part of quality control. The extract powder must be free from harmful microorganisms such as bacteria, fungi, and viruses. Tests are conducted to detect the presence of pathogens and to ensure that the total microbial count is within acceptable limits. If any microbial contamination is detected, appropriate measures such as sterilization or rejection of the batch are taken.
4. Potential Applications
Medicinal Marshmallow Extract powder has a wide range of potential applications in the medical and healthcare fields.
4.1. Respiratory Health
The mucilage present in the extract has soothing properties that can be beneficial for respiratory health. It can help to relieve coughs and soothe irritated throats. In some traditional medicine practices, marshmallow extract has been used to treat bronchitis and other respiratory infections. It may work by coating the mucous membranes in the respiratory tract, reducing inflammation and irritation.
4.2. Digestive Aid
For digestive health, the extract powder can play an important role. The mucilage can form a protective layer in the digestive tract, protecting the mucosa from irritation. It may also help to relieve symptoms of indigestion, such as heartburn and stomach discomfort. Additionally, it has been suggested that it can have a mild laxative effect, promoting regular bowel movements.
4.3. Skin Health
When applied topically, Medicinal Marshmallow Extract powder can be beneficial for skin health. It has moisturizing properties due to its mucilage content, which can help to keep the skin hydrated. It may also have anti - inflammatory effects, making it useful in treating skin conditions such as eczema and dermatitis. Some skincare products incorporate marshmallow extract powder for its soothing and nourishing properties.
5. Safety Concerns
While Medicinal Marshmallow Extract powder has many potential benefits, there are also some safety concerns to be aware of.
5.1. Allergic Reactions
Some individuals may be allergic to marshmallow plants. Allergic reactions can range from mild skin rashes to more severe symptoms such as difficulty breathing and anaphylaxis in rare cases. It is important for manufacturers to clearly label their products and for consumers to be aware of any potential allergies they may have.
5.2. Interaction with Medications
There is a possibility that Medicinal Marshmallow Extract powder may interact with certain medications. For example, it may affect the absorption of some drugs in the digestive tract. Therefore, it is advisable for patients taking medications to consult their healthcare providers before using marshmallow extract products.
